how to stop bookmarks from automatically opening with new safari tab

On the iPad 6 howto stop the bookmark icon from automatically opening with new safari tab?

iPad, iOS 12

I beleive you a refering to a deliberate feature of Safari, whereby it will automatically open the favorites/history panel. You should be able to disable this feature as follows.


Tap the “+” icon at top-right of your Safari screen; a new tab will open. If the new tab opens with the favorites/history panel open, then the “book” icon at top-left will be highlighted in blue.


To disable this feature, from the just-opened new tab (which will be showing a page of icons corresponding to saved web pages, tap the “book” icon to remove the blue highlight - then close the tab. Next time that you tap the “+” icon to open a new tab, the favorites/history sidebar will not appear.


To reverse this action, such that the favorites/history panel does appear upon opening a new tab, simply touch the “book” icon from the new tab (the icon will again be highlighted in blue) - and close the new tab.
